Angela Masten, MRC, ATP, GCD
Angie has been with the Wright State Office of Disability Services in a variety of capacities since 2007 and is currently a Case Manager. Additionally, she has taught the Assistive Technology & Independent Living, Medical Aspects of Disability, Community Resources, and Employment of People with Disabilities courses for the Rehabilitation Services program. She volunteers with WrightChoice Mentoring created by her mentor, TyKiah Wright-Wilson. She lives in Dayton, Ohio with her husband, three dogs, and two tortoises.
Education History
Master of Rehabilitation Counseling, Severe Disabilities Concentration; Wright State University, 2012
Bachelor of Science in Rehabilitation Services; Wright State Universtiy, 2008
